Understanding hydraulic efficiency

Hydraulic efficiency refers to the ratio of useful work output to the total energy input in a hydraulic system. Low efficiency often stems from leaks, pressure drops, or malfunctioning components. The integration of smart hydraulic check valve repair techniques and advanced air management strategies can significantly improve this ratio, ensuring minimal energy waste and maximum performance.

Common Issues Affecting Hydraulic Systems

Despite advancements in technology, hydraulic systems still face several challenges. One major issue is air contamination, which can lead to instability and reduced efficiency. Additionally, wornout check valves can cause pressure fluctuations and energy loss. roper maintenance and timely repairs are essential to mitigate these problems.

Enhancing erformance with Hydraulic Check Valve Repair

Check valves play a critical role in maintaining unidirectional flow and preventing backflow. However, over time, they can degrade due to wear, corrosion, or improper installation. Hydraulic check valve repair involves diagnosing issues and implementing targeted fixes to restore functionality. Modern repair methods, such as laser welding or thermal spray coatings, can extend the lifespan of these components while maintaining hydraulic efficiency.

The Importance of Air Management in Hydraulic Systems

Hydraulic system air management is often overlooked but is crucial for optimal operation. Air pockets in the system can cause cavitation, noise, and reduced responsiveness. roper filtration and deaeration techniques are necessary to eliminate air contaminants and maintain smooth functioning.

Combining Repair and Air Management for Maximum Benefit

The synergy between hydraulic check valve repair and hydraulic system air management is undeniable. When check valves are in top condition, the system can better handle air fluctuations. Conversely, effective air management reduces stress on valves, extending their lifespan. Together, they create a robust framework for peak performance.
